In this table, you find the errors and alerts that may affect your Neato D8, D9, or D10. The error code is visible in your MyNeato app. Please follow the indicated troubleshooting steps to resolve the issue.

ERROR CODEMEANINGTROUBLESHOOT

1007

Update install error

Contact customer care for a manual update. 
1008-
1018
Update install error

Robot will retry to update automatically.

Perform a reset, then try to update again.
If error persists, contact customer care for a manual update. 

1021Charge your robot

Robot could not update the software because its battery is too low. Put the robot on the charge base to charge. It will update automatically once battery is charged.

 
2001Not on the ground

The robot is not on level ground. Place the robot back on level ground.
If the issue persists, contact customer care.

2002Not on level ground

The robot is tilted. Place the robot back on level ground.

Check the wheels by pressing them.

2003Dirt bin is open

Place the dirt bin back in the cavity and make sure it is inserted correctly.

2101Path is blockedRemove objects that may be blocking the robot.
2102/
2103
Not on level groundPlace robot on level ground.
If issue persists, clean the wheel sensor.
2105-2107Too close to an edge

Move the robot away from the edge and place it on level ground. Then continue the clean.
If issue persists, reset the robot.

2110Can't find base

Pick the robot up and return it manually to its charge base.

2111Press start to continuePress start. If the issue persists, reset the robot, then restart the cleaning run.
2114Too close to an edgeMove the robot from the edge and place it on level ground. Continue the clean.
2201
2202
2203
Right sensor dirty
Left sensor dirty
Rear sensor dirty
Clean the sensors.
If issue persists, reset the robot.
2204Brush is stuckRemove the brush and clear from any debris.
2207Side brush is stuckRemove the side brush and clear from any debris. Reinsert and test if it can turn freely.

2210
2211

Right wheel is stuck
Left wheel is stuck
Remove debris around the wheel.
 
4003Internal errorPlease contact customer care.
4101Sensor failure

Clean the main laser.

Perform a soft reset.

If the issue still persists, please contact customer care.

4102Sensor failurePlease contact customer care.
4202Battery can't chargePlease contact customer care.
 
5001Dirt bin is fullEmpty the dirt bin.
5002Replace filterReplace the filter on the dirt bin.
5003Replace brushReplace the main brush.
 
6001Invalid commandRestart your robot.
 
7100DockedThe robot is fully charged and ready to start cleaning.
7101Battery is lowWait for the robot to charge and start cleaning.
7102Place on charge basePlace the robot back on the charge base.
